×
×
Saturday
22
Mar 2025
weather symbol
Athens 16°C

> UAV

> UAV

The Greek drone SARISA unleashes lethal rocket – A first in UAV warfare (photos)

The Hydra 70 rocket was launched for the first time in the world from a small, easily transportable drone

The secret behind Russia’s swarms of deadly drones

The swarms of kamikaze drones ravaging Ukraine are cheap and deadly, and they represent a terrifying new form of warfare unleashed by an unlikely source

As fighting rages in Ukraine, the US is sending drones to keep an eye on another tense corner of Europe

Larissa Air Base which is located in central Greece near the Aegean Sea, "is a strategic location"

Albanian PM Edi Rama on Turkish relations: “Thank you is not enough for my friend Erdogan”

Albania signed a deal to buy Turkish drones

Previous
Load more